Title: Fei Liu: Innovator in Cell Culture Technology
Introduction
Fei Liu is a prominent inventor based in Warwick, Rhode Island, known for his contributions to the field of cell culture technology. With a total of two patents to his name, Liu has made significant advancements that enhance the understanding of cell dynamics and interactions.
Latest Patents
Liu's latest patents include a bio-matrix stretcher, which provides innovative techniques for measuring and characterizing the dynamics of cell traction forces. This invention features tunable elastic gel substrates that can be arranged in multi-well plates, allowing for a uniform predetermined thickness. The multi-well plate can be loaded with gels of varying shear moduli, and an array of punch indenters can be attached to a loading platen. These indenters apply tensile or compressive strains to the gel substrates, with the magnitude, duration, and frequency of the strain controlled by a motor assembly linked to a control system. This apparatus is designed for long-term cell culture experiments, enabling observation of cell behavior under strain. Another patent involves a multi-well culture plate that supports a range of compliant substrates, allowing for the testing of cellular responses across a plate with shear modulus from 50 to 51,200 Pascals. The plates are compatible with standard 96-well and 384-well assays, supporting the attachment and growth of various cell types.
